Nature, growth and jealousy
Green Heart carries the associations green does generally: nature, growth, health and environmental themes. It is the standard heart in anything gardening, hiking or sustainability related.
It also has a minor secondary reading of envy, from the English idiom about being green with jealousy - though that sense is far weaker than the nature one and rarely intended.

Consistent rendering
Like the other original coloured hearts it needs no variation selector and takes no modifiers, and vendor designs differ only slightly in shade.
Its colour is distinct enough from the blue and yellow hearts to remain distinguishable at 32 pixels, which is not true of every pair in the set.
Colour symbolism, mostly intact
Like the other original hearts it came from the carrier sets and inherited its meaning from what green already signified: growth, nature, health.
The envy reading exists but is weak, because it depends on an English idiom that does not translate. On an international server it is rarely the intended meaning and rarely the received one.
Its gaming use - health, safe states, regeneration - is a much stronger association for most Discord users than either.

As a standard Unicode emoji rather than a Discord custom emoji, this renders anywhere text does and needs no server or Nitro. Each platform draws it with its own emoji font, so the artwork differs between Android, iOS, Windows and Mac while the character and its meaning stay identical.
